클라이언트 프로토콜 구성Configure Client Protocols

이 항목 적용 대상: 예SQL Server없습니다Azure SQL 데이터베이스없습니다Azure SQL 데이터 웨어하우스 없습니다 병렬 데이터 웨어하우스THIS TOPIC APPLIES TO: yesSQL ServernoAzure SQL DatabasenoAzure SQL Data Warehouse noParallel Data Warehouse

이 항목에서는 SQL Server 2017SQL Server 2017 구성 관리자를 사용하여 SQL ServerSQL Server에서 클라이언트 응용 프로그램이 사용하는 클라이언트 프로토콜을 구성하는 방법에 대해 설명합니다.This topic describes how to configure client protocols used by client applications in SQL Server 2017SQL Server 2017 by using SQL ServerSQL Server Configuration Manager. Microsoft SQL ServerSQL Server는 TCP/IP 네트워크 프로토콜 및 명명된 파이프 프로토콜을 통한 클라이언트 통신을 지원합니다.Microsoft SQL ServerSQL Server supports client communication with the TCP/IP network protocol and the named pipes protocol. 클라이언트가 동일 컴퓨터의 데이터베이스 엔진Database Engine 인스턴스에 연결하고 있는 경우 공유 메모리 프로토콜도 사용할 수 있습니다.The shared memory protocol is also available if the client is connecting to an instance of the 데이터베이스 엔진Database Engine on the same computer. 일반적으로 프로토콜을 선택하는 방법에는 3가지가 있습니다.There are three common methods of selecting the protocol.

SQL Server 구성 관리자 사용Using SQL Server Configuration Manager

클라이언트 프로토콜을 사용하거나 사용하지 않으려면To enable or disable a client protocol

  1. SQL ServerSQL Server 구성 관리자에서 SQL Server Native Client 구성을 확장하고 클라이언트 프로토콜을 마우스 오른쪽 단추로 클릭한 다음 속성을 클릭합니다.In SQL ServerSQL Server Configuration Manager, expand SQL Server Native Client Configuration, right-click Client Protocols, and then click Properties.

  2. 사용할 수 없는 프로토콜 상자에서 프로토콜을 클릭한 다음 사용을 클릭하여 프로토콜을 사용할 수 있게 합니다.Click a protocol in the Disabled Protocols box, and then click Enable, to enable a protocol.

  3. 사용할 수 있는 프로토콜 상자에서 프로토콜을 클릭한 다음 사용 안 함을 클릭하여 프로토콜을 사용할 수 없게 합니다.Click a protocol in the Enabled Protocols box, and then click Disable, to disable a protocol.

클라이언트 컴퓨터의 기본 프로토콜이나 프로토콜 순서를 변경하려면To change the default protocol or the protocol order for client computers

  1. SQL ServerSQL Server 구성 관리자에서 SQL Server Native Client 구성을 확장하고 클라이언트 프로토콜을 마우스 오른쪽 단추로 클릭한 다음 속성을 클릭합니다.In SQL ServerSQL Server Configuration Manager, expand SQL Server Native Client Configuration, right-click Client Protocols, and then click Properties.

  2. 사용할 수 있는 프로토콜 상자에서 위로 이동 이나 아래로 이동을 클릭하여 SQL ServerSQL Server에 연결을 시도할 때 사용되는 프로토콜 순서를 변경합니다.In the Enabled Protocols box, click Move Up or Move Down, to change the order in which protocols are tried, when attempting to connect to SQL ServerSQL Server. 사용할 수 있는 프로토콜 상자의 가장 위에 있는 프로토콜은 기본 프로토콜입니다.The top protocol in the Enabled Protocols box is the default protocol.

    중요

    SQL ServerSQL Server 구성 관리자는 서버 별칭 구성과 기본 클라이언트 네트워크 라이브러리에 대한 레지스트리 항목을 만듭니다. Configuration Manager creates registry entries for the server alias configurations and default client network library. 하지만 응용 프로그램은 SQL ServerSQL Server 클라이언트 네트워크 라이브러리 또는 네트워크 프로토콜을 설치하지 않습니다.However, the application does not install either the SQL ServerSQL Server client network libraries or the network protocols. SQL ServerSQL Server 클라이언트 네트워크 라이브러리는 SQL ServerSQL Server 설치 중에 함께 설치되며 네트워크 프로토콜은 Microsoft Windows 설치 프로그램의 일부로 설치되거나 제어판네트워크를 통해 설치됩니다.The SQL ServerSQL Server client network libraries are installed during SQL ServerSQL Server Setup; the network protocols are installed as part of Microsoft Windows Setup (or through Networks in Control Panel). 특정 네트워크 프로토콜은 Windows 설치 프로그램의 일부로 제공되지 않을 수 있습니다.A particular network protocol may not be available as part of Windows Setup. 이러한 네트워크 프로토콜을 설치하는 방법은 공급업체 설명서를 참조하십시오.For more information about installing these network protocols, see the vendor documentation.

클라이언트에서 TCP/IP를 사용하도록 구성하려면To configure a client to use TCP/IP

  1. SQL ServerSQL Server 구성 관리자에서 SQL Server Native Client 구성을 확장하고 클라이언트 프로토콜을 마우스 오른쪽 단추로 클릭한 다음 속성을 클릭합니다.In SQL ServerSQL Server Configuration Manager, expand SQL Server Native Client Configuration, right-click Client Protocols, and then click Properties.

  2. 사용할 수 있는 프로토콜 상자에서 아래 또는 위로 화살표를 클릭하여 SQL Server에 연결할 때 사용할 프로토콜의 순서를 변경합니다.In the Enabled Protocols box, click the up and down arrows to change the order in which protocols are tried, when attempting to connect to SQL Server. 사용할 수 있는 프로토콜 상자의 가장 위에 있는 프로토콜은 기본 프로토콜입니다.The top protocol in the Enabled Protocols box is the default protocol.

    공유 메모리 프로토콜은 공유 메모리 프로토콜 사용 확인란을 선택하여 별도로 설정됩니다.The shared memory protocol is enabled separately by checking the Enabled Shared Memory Protocol box.

참고 항목See Also

원격 로그인 제한 시간 서버 구성 옵션 구성Configure the remote login timeout Server Configuration Option